Jewelry Care




To maintain the beauty of your jewelry over time, we recommend the following care tips:


1. Storage

Wipe jewelry with a soft cloth and store it in a jewelry case or sealed bag.

Keep Sterling Silver(Silver 925) away from air and moisture; avoid humid places like bathrooms and direct sunlight.


2. Wear & Use

Apply perfumes, lotions, or sprays before wearing jewelry.

Avoid contact with sweat, salt, or chemicals to prevent tarnishing.

Jewelry may naturally tarnish or get damaged over time with use. Silver 925, in particular, can lose its shine over time, so regular checks and cleaning by a professional will help maintain its cleanliness and luster.


3. Cleaning

Use a polishing cloth for minor tarnish.

For severe tarnish, use a silver cleaner or consult a professional.


4. Sterling Silver(Silver 925) Characteristics

Sterling Silver is a premium material composed of 92.5% pure silver and 7.5% other metals, widely used in jewelry making.

Sterling Silver is soft and prone to scratches and deformation. Handle carefully and avoid impact. Regular maintenance preserves its original luster.



TIP: FIXING ONE-TOUCH EARRING ISSUES

Most BMTL earring posts are made of Silver 925 to minimize allergies. Silver’s softness may cause slight deformation, leading to closure issues. This is a natural occurrence due to the physical properties of silver and is not a defect in the product.


How to Fix

1. Gently adjust the post up or down to align with the clasp.

2. If the adjustment is done right, the earring should click when properly closed.


*Caution*

• Avoid using excessive force.

• If the product temperature is too cold, warm the post with your hands before adjusting.
